The Coordinator Projects II is responsible for the administration and coordination of the department and team's various aspects of project plans, communications, and support deliverables. The Project Coordinator is responsible for vendor negotiations and site logistics as well as providing on-site program coordination. The incumbent must work independently and establish procedures and work flows as necessary. The Coordinator Projects deals with highly sensitive and confidential information and interacts with internal and external partners at all levels throughout the organization.

In 1999, two historic Catholic charities became one, forming CHRISTUS Health and creating a unique purpose in the modern health care market - to take better care of people.
To extend the healing ministry of Jesus Christ, the mission that the Sisters of Charity Health Care system and Incarnate Word Health system shared for more than a century, is now also the mission of CHRISTUS Health.
Ranked among the top 10 Catholic health systems in the United States by size, the CHRISTUS Health system includes more than 40 hospitals and facilities in seven U.S. states, Chile and six states in Mexico, with assets of more than $4.6 billion.
Whether seeking care in Alexandria Louisiana, or Coahuila, Mexico, patients discover that the healing spirit is alive at CHRISTUS Health.
